Egypt's Marimba band, led by Nesma Abdel-Aziz, along with the Tanoura Troupe, are set to participate in the Vienna African Arts Festival, to be held in Austria.

The Marimba band will perform several pieces, such as Souad Hosny's famous Ya Wad Ya Teqeel, as well as others by Om Kalthum, Warda, and Fayrouz.

Abdel-Aziz began her career in 2001, when she performed with renowned muscian and composer Omar Khairat. She later started her own band to work on personal projects.

Considered to be one of the best Marimba players in the Arab world, Abdel-Aziz studied at the Cairo Conservatory of Music, before traveling to continue her studies in the United States.
